The online casino industry has undergone significant transformations since its inception. One of the key events that marked the beginning of this era was the launch of the first online casino, InterCasino, in 1994. This pioneering move paved the way for the development of subsequent online casinos. As the industry grew, so did the need for regulatory frameworks. In 2000, the introduction of the Kahnawake Gaming Commission provided much-needed oversight and legitimacy to online gaming. This move helped establish trust among players and operators alike, setting the stage for further expansion.
A Brief History of Online Gambling
The history of online gambling is marked by several significant milestones. The following table highlights some of the most notable events:
| Year | Milestone | Description | Impact |
| 1994 | First Online Casino Launched | The first online casino, InterCasino, goes live. | Marks the beginning of online gambling. |
| 2000 | Regulatory Framework Established | The introduction of the Kahnawake Gaming Commission. | Provides legitimacy and oversight. |
| 2006 | UIGEA Enacted | The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act is passed. | Affects U.S. online gambling landscape. |
| 2010 | Rise of Mobile Casinos | First mobile-optimized casinos launched. | Expands access to gambling. |
| 2020 | Live Dealer Games Introduced | Live streaming technology transforms online gaming. | Enhances user experience and engagement. |
These milestones demonstrate the evolution of the online casino industry, from its humble beginnings to the sophisticated, technologically advanced sector it is today.
The Technological Advancements in Online Casinos
The Role of Software Providers
Software providers have played a crucial role in shaping the online casino industry. Companies like Microgaming, NetEnt, and Playtech have developed innovative games and platforms that have enhanced the user experience. These advancements have enabled casinos to offer a wide range of games, including slots, blackjack, and roulette, to a global audience. The quality and variety of games have significantly improved over the years, making online casinos more appealing to players.

Innovations in Payment Methods
The online casino industry has also seen significant innovations in payment methods. The introduction of e-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ller has made it easier for players to deposit and withdraw funds.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in have also gained popularity, offering a secure and anonymous way to conduct transactions. These advancements have improved the overall gaming experience, providing players with more convenient and secure payment options.
The Impact of Regulation on Online Casinos
Global Regulatory Landscape
The regulatory landscape for online casinos varies across different regions. In the UK, the Gambling Commission is responsible for overseeing the industry, ensuring that operators comply with strict guidelines and regulations. Similarly, in the US, the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) has had a significant impact on the online gambling landscape. Understanding the regulatory environment is essential for operators to ensure compliance and for players to ensure they are playing at reputable, licensed casinos.
The Role of Licensing Authorities
Licensing authorities play a critical role in regulating the online casino industry. Organizations like the Malta Gaming Authority and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ority issue licenses to operators, ensuring they meet strict standards and guidelines. These licenses provide a level of assurance for players, indicating that the casino is reputable and operates fairly.
